Streaks in direction of paper travel
There are dark lines running along
the page in the direction of paper
travel from the leading edge to the
trailing edge (B-size print shown).
The printer displays no error code.
Note
A-size prints are processed
through the printer with the short
edge of the print parallel to the
direction of the paper path --
making horizontal print artifacts
parallel to the shot edge of the
print.
B-size prints are processed
through the printer with the long
edge of the print parallel to the
paper path -- making horizontal
artifacts parallel to the long axis
of the print.
1.
Check the end of life for each of
the consumables by printing the
supplies usage page. From the front panel's Printable Pages Menu, select
Print Supplies Page.
2.
Run the solid fill test pages; From the front panel's Printable Pages Menu,
select Service Pages, then select Print Solid Fill Pages. If the missing bands
only occur in a single primary color, replace the print cartridge of the affected
color.
3.
Swap print cartridges and run another test print.
Note
Under some circumstances, streaking may occur in the margin of
SRA3-size paper. This is due to the edges of the paper extending
beyond the end of the imaging components. print-quality in the
margins of SRA3 paper is not guaranteed.
4.
Inspect the Accumulator Belt cleaner; replace the cleaner, if necessary.
5.
Run the Remove Print Smears routine. From the front panel's Support Menu,
select Improve Print-Quality?, then select Remove Print Smears.
6.
Replace the Developer Housing Assembly (RRP 27, on page 7-171).
7.
Remove the print cartridge and (with a flashlight) check for debris along the
edge of the developer housing.
